Transaction cd640c70b332b58b5e388725c103d0727e30638309c5cac6aa71e71aa2a26429

1 Input
2 Outputs
  • cd640c70b332b58b5e388725c103d0727e30638309c5cac6aa71e71aa2a26429:0
  • value  440042284
    address  164FEyZjDuQEGD98uuMNYQTBoEuuamw18b
  • cd640c70b332b58b5e388725c103d0727e30638309c5cac6aa71e71aa2a26429:1
  • value  4389223
    address  1BtLRNmDGGXjZZ2ieodxTJUwtr4EZ2xM6z